Aleix Espargaró's MotoGP Journey: From Reluctance to Triumph with Aprilia

Aleix Espargaró's remarkable eight-year journey with Aprilia, culminating in his decision to transition to a test rider role for Honda in 2024, stands as a testament to perseverance and unexpected success. Initially, the idea of moving to Aprilia was far from appealing for the Spanish rider. Having enjoyed a prominent position with Suzuki, Espargaró viewed Aprilia as a less competitive option, a sentiment driven by his professional pride. However, this partnership ultimately blossomed into the most defining and fruitful period of his career, yielding all of his Grand Prix victories and a significant majority of his podium finishes, a legacy that reshaped perceptions and proved his enduring capability on the track.

Reflecting on his career-defining move, Espargaró openly shared his initial hesitations about joining Aprilia. After his time with Suzuki, a team he considered top-tier despite not securing race wins, he found himself at a crossroads. His inherent competitiveness and strong self-belief made the prospect of moving to a team perceived as struggling, like Aprilia, difficult to accept. He confessed that his professional ego initially prevented him from even considering their offer, viewing it as a step backward in his illustrious career. This internal struggle highlights the mental fortitude often required of elite athletes when faced with pivotal career decisions.

Despite his reluctance, circumstances, coupled with the persistent guidance of his agent, eventually led Espargaró to reconsider. With limited alternatives on the horizon, his manager urged him to view the Aprilia offer not as a decline, but as a significant challenge and an opportunity to redefine his narrative. This encouragement prompted Espargaró to embrace the uphill battle, fueled by a desire to prove doubters wrong. He recalled the widespread skepticism from those who believed this move signaled the end of his competitive days, a perception he was determined to dismantle through his performance on the track.

The decision to join Aprilia, born out of necessity and a will to prove his capabilities, irrevocably shaped Espargaró's professional life. Over eight seasons, he not only found a stable environment but also unlocked unprecedented success, securing three Grand Prix victories and 10 of his 12 career podiums. This sustained performance silenced critics and solidified his reputation as a formidable competitor.
